The duration required to complete a five-mile run varies significantly based on individual factors. These factors include the runner’s fitness level, pace, and the terrain. For instance, a seasoned marathon runner might complete the distance in approximately 30-40 minutes, while a novice runner might require upwards of an hour. Environmental conditions, such as temperature and wind, can also influence the total time.

Understanding the anticipated completion time for a five-mile run can be beneficial for several reasons. It aids in effective training program design, allows for accurate race-day pacing strategies, and contributes to a realistic assessment of personal fitness progress.
